Painting Canada:Tom Thomson & the Group of Seven
November 3, 2012 to January 6, 2013 After a tremendous tour in Europe, Painting Canada: Tom Thomson and the Group of Seven is coming to the McMichael, the only Canadian venue for this exhibition.

Black History Month and Kickoff Brunch
The OBHS is the organization in Canada that successfully has initiated the formal celebration of February as Black History Month, at all levels of government, through the OBHS Brunch held annually on the last Sunday of January launching BHM

COBA presents Diasporic Dimensions
During Black History Month, Toronto's leading black dance company, COBA (Collective of Black Artists), premieres 3 new works and reprises Maa Keeba, its tribute to the late legendary singer Miriam Makeba.
